Heads up — the Fernhollow orphaned-resource sweeper just deleted way more objects than its rolling baseline (threshold is 3x the seven-day average). Usually this means a tagging change upstream made healthy resources look orphaned, not that we suddenly grew that much junk. The sweeper auto-pauses when this fires, so nothing else gets removed until someone reviews the candidate list. Since you're reviewing the tagging PR, please double-check the exclusion rules before unpausing. Candidate list and unpause procedure are on this page.

dashboard of kafop-yagep = https://jira.zemvarsys.internal/pages/pages/pages/display/cc87

**Alert: RestockPlanner-StaleForecast**

The Snackwright vending restock planner has not produced a route plan in over 90 minutes. Field crews in the Delmarrow region pull plans at 06:00, so a stale forecast means trucks leave with yesterday's loadout. Check the demand-feed consumer first; it stalls when the telemetry queue backs up. Escalate to the Snackwright platform team if restart fails. Runbook is at the page below.

operations page: https://jenkins.zemvarcloud.local/job/merge_requests/repo/build/73930b4b30f0a8ed

**Large-Deal Discount Policy — Managers Only**

Effective immediately: deals above 250k require VP sign-off for any discount over 12%. Below that threshold, regional managers may approve up to 8%. Stacking promotional credits with volume discounts is prohibited. All exceptions route through Deal Desk at Corvane Systems within 48 hours. Quarterly audits begin next cycle; non-compliant deals will be clawed back from commission. Margins on the Ledgermark line are under pressure, so enforcement will be strict. Context for the board follows below.

internal memo for kawip-hadug: Headcount on the Wenwyn team goes from 7 to 140 by the end of January. Gross margin on Wenwyn came in at 20 percent against a plan of 15 percent.

Handover note — Ledgerline payments integration tests

For future maintainers: the flaky suite is almost entirely timing-related. The mock acquirer in the Tallbrook sandbox responds slower under parallel runs, so settlement assertions race. I bumped timeouts and pinned the suite to two workers; pass rate is ~98% now. Remaining flakes trace to the webhook replayer. Its sealed test vault must be reopened each quarter using the recovery phrase below.

vault phrase of bagaf-kajeg = jorath-feniel-briir-siliel-ralix